" Red Wine Bali":
Bali is significantly recognized for its regional red wine manufacturing. "Hatten Wines" and "Plaga Red wine" are two popular regional manufacturers supplying a series of red wines.
Along with regional alternatives, imported red wines from Australia, Chile, and various other areas are commonly available in Bali.

Exploring Regional Beverages:
Beyond imported red wines and spirits, Bali uses a variety of one-of-a-kind regional beverages:
Arak: A traditional Balinese spirit made from fermented rice or hand sap.
Brem: A sweet rice a glass of wine.
Tuak: A palm a glass of wine.
Checking out these local beverages can supply a fascinating peek into Balinese society.
